It comes as no surprise that The Sims franchise is one of the best selling games of all time. EA announced today that The Sims just reached the 100-million mark since it’s initial release in 2000. The series is sold worldwide in 60 countries with 22 different translations. The New York Times states that the series has generated over $4 billion for it’s publisher, Electronic Arts.

Sony, in conjunction with Fallon London agency, have been creating quirky and creative ads as part of their “like.no.other” campaign for the past few years. From 250,000 bouncy balls overrunning a major city to a giant Play-Doh whale-tail transforming rabbit, Sony has proven to be successful in properly promoting its punctuation-laden slogan.
